The Databricks Machine Learning Professional certification is a highly regarded credential for data scientists, ML engineers, and advanced analytics professionals who want to prove their expertise in designing and deploying machine learning solutions on the Databricks platform. This exam covers a wide range of topics, including feature engineering, data preprocessing, MLFlow tracking, hyperparameter optimization, and scalable ML deployment. Its purpose is not only to test theoretical knowledge but also to validate practical skills in handling enterprise-grade machine learning workflows. For professionals working within Microsoft Azure Databricks, this certification is especially important because it demonstrates the ability to integrate ML solutions into cloud-native architectures, making it a critical milestone for those aiming to contribute to Microsoft’s AI-driven data strategies.


In real exam scenarios, candidates are required to solve practical problems like building end-to-end ML pipelines, performing distributed training on Spark clusters, deploying models into production, and setting up monitoring for drift detection.
